php怎么输出字符串

PHP是一种流行的服务器端脚本语言,用于开发动态网页和Web应用程序。在PHP中,输出字符串是一个基本操作,可以使用多种方法来实现。

1. echo语句

最基本的输出字符串的方法是使用echo语句。echo语句用于将字符串直接输出到浏览器。以下是一个示例:

echo "Hello World!";

?>

上述代码将输出字符串"Hello World!"到浏览器。

echo语句的优点是简单易懂,适用于简单的输出操作。但是,echo语句只能输出字符串,不能直接输出其他数据类型。

2. print语句

除了echo语句,PHP还提供了print语句用于输出字符串。print语句也可以用于输出其他数据类型。以下是一个示例:

print "Hello World!";

?>

上述代码与使用echo语句的示例效果相同。

print语句的优点是可以输出任意数据类型的值,而不仅限于字符串。

3. 使用变量输出字符串

在PHP中,也可以使用变量来输出字符串。可以将字符串赋值给一个变量,然后通过输出该变量来输出字符串。以下是一个示例:

$message = "Hello World!";

echo $message;

?>

上述代码通过将字符串"Hello World!"赋值给变量$message,然后通过输出变量$message来输出字符串。

3.1 使用字符串拼接

除了直接输出变量外,还可以使用字符串拼接的方式输出字符串。可以通过连接运算符"."将多个字符串拼接为一个字符串。以下是一个示例:

$hello = "Hello";

$world = "World!";

echo $hello . " " . $world;

?>

上述代码将输出字符串"Hello World!"。通过连接运算符将变量$hello、空格字符串和变量$world拼接为一个字符串。

字符串拼接的优点是可以动态生成字符串,方便处理复杂的输出需求。

4. 使用printf函数

除了echo和print语句外,PHP还提供了printf函数用于格式化输出。printf函数可以根据指定的格式输出字符串。以下是一个示例:

$name = "John";

$age = 25;

printf("My name is %s and I am %d years old.", $name, $age);

?>

上述代码使用printf函数输出格式化的字符串。%s是格式化字符串中的占位符,表示字符串类型;%d是表示整数类型的占位符。

使用printf函数可以更灵活地控制字符串的输出格式,并且可以输出多个变量的值。

综上所述,PHP可以使用echo语句、print语句、变量输出、字符串拼接以及printf函数等方法来输出字符串。具体使用哪种方法取决于需求的复杂程度以及对输出结果的要求。以上的示例和说明是相互独立的,可以根据自己的需要选择适合的方法。

后端开发标签